Claims Officer
Responsibilities
Under the supervision of
the Head of Claims, the incumbent will carry out the following functions:
Review,
processing, and settlement of claims per under Group Claims Underwriting Manual.
Preparation
of claims memos for supervisor approval and follow up with Finance team to
ensure timely settlement per internal turnaround times.
Review
and acknowledge claims notification received from cedants and brokers.
Maintain
proper records of all claims notification and follow up to logical conclusion.
Keep
an audit trail of all reported claims.
Respond
promptly and accurately to cedants and brokers queries.
Prompt
processing of reported reinsurance claims recoveries and ensure reinsurance
shares are correctly calculated.
Prepare
claims files for management review and approvals.
Provide
and deliver quality services to cedants and brokers.
Promptly
process and monitor the development of the outstanding claims provision.
Generate
and prepare progress claims reports (monthly/quarterly/annual) and any other
management claim reports from the business objects reporting module of SICs
system.
Prompt
request of claims supporting documents from cedants and brokers such as policy
wordings, adjuster’s reports, cession bordereaux, debit notes etc.
Review
and timely processing of Cash Calls, as well as manage the follow up and
reconciliation of cash call credit refunds.
Review,
recommendation, and processing of loss reserves.
Review
and flagging off contentious claims issues to supervisor such as wrong cessions
to treaty/facultative contracts, liability attachment etc.
Maintenance
of notified claims lists report and follow up with clients for reserves updates
and documentation.
Review,
monitoring, and processing of reinstatement premiums as well as maintenance of
reports.
Monitoring
and validation of adjustment premiums for prior years and following up to
ensure they have been processed timeously.
Assistance
on reconciliation of accounts on claims with outstanding premiums.
